Abstract
A spherical element having a subjoined rotatable base, a spool element journalled for rotation within the sphere and fixed to said base, a photo strip normally wound on said spool, handle means disposed on the outer end of the photo strip for withdrawing the strip for viewing, and retraction of said strip to be effected by manual reverse rotation of said base.

A spool is journalled within the top portion of the body member and fixed at the lower end thereof in the rotatable base. An elongated strip of photos is wound about the spool. The free end of the strip extends thru a vertical slot laterally disposed in the body wall and terminates with the free end thereof fastened to an elongated arcuate strap member normally held exteriorly against the body portion wall. an arcuate member or handle. The sphere may be colored and lined as a basketball, baseball or other sphere employed in a sport, and the photo strip carries pictures of team members as a souvenir. The strip is retracted by manual rotation of the base.
BRIEF DESCRIPTION OF THE DRAWINGS FIG. 1 is a vertical cross-sectional view of the souvenir assembly embodying the invention.
FIG. 2 is a cross-sectional view taken on line 2-2 of FIG. 1.
FIG. 3 is a horizontal central cross-sectional view of the device.
FIG. 4 is a perspective of the device.
DETAILED DESCRIPTION As shown in FIG. 1, the device has a spherical body 11 engaged with a rotatable base 12 which latter has a circular upstanding portion 13 journalled in the central bottom aperture at 14 of the body portion 11.
The upstanding portion 13 has a central vertical square bore at 15 in which is fixed the lower end 16 of the spool 17 which carries the wound strip of photos The upper end 20 of the spool 17 is journaled in the top central circular element 21 within the body portion 11.
Manual rotation of the base portion 12 will easily retract the photo strip 18 for safe keeping within the device.
